谷歌云代理商:如何通过谷歌云Data Fusion整合异构数据
引言
在当今数据驱动的商业环境中,企业往往需要处理来自不同来源、格式各异的数据。这些异构数据可能包括结构化数据(如关系型数据库)、半结构化数据(如JSON、XML)和非结构化数据(如文本、图像)。如何高效整合这些异构数据,成为企业数据管理的关键挑战之一。谷歌云Data Fusion作为一款强大的数据集成工具,为企业提供了简单、高效的解决方案。
什么是谷歌云Data Fusion?
谷歌云Data Fusion是基于开源项目CDAP(Cask Data application Platform)构建的完全托管服务,旨在简化数据集成和ETL(提取、转换、加载)流程。它提供了一个可视化的界面,允许用户通过拖放方式构建数据处理管道,无需编写复杂的代码。
谷歌云的优势
- 完全托管的服务:谷歌云Data Fusion是一个完全托管的服务,用户无需担心基础设施的维护和扩展,可以专注于数据集成本身。
- 可视化界面:通过直观的可视化界面,用户可以轻松构建复杂的数据管道,无需编写代码,降低了技术门槛。
- 强大的扩展性:Data Fusion支持多种数据源和目标,包括关系型数据库、NoSQL数据库、云存储、大数据平台等,能够满足企业多样化的数据需求。
- 与谷歌云生态的无缝集成:Data Fusion可以无缝集成谷歌云的其他服务,如BigQuery、Cloud Storage、Pub/Sub等,形成完整的数据处理和分析解决方案。
- 高性能和可靠性:基于谷歌云的全球基础设施,Data Fusion能够提供高性能的数据处理能力和高可用性,确保数据管道的稳定运行。
如何通过Data Fusion整合异构数据?
以下是使用谷歌云Data Fusion整合异构数据的步骤:
- 创建Data Fusion实例:在谷歌云控制台中创建一个Data Fusion实例,选择合适的版本和配置。
- 连接到数据源:在Data Fusion界面中,配置连接器以访问不同的数据源,例如MySQL、PostgreSQL、MongoDB、Cloud Storage等。
- 设计数据管道:使用可视化界面拖放组件,设计数据管道。例如,可以从MySQL数据库中提取数据,经过转换后加载到BigQuery中。
- 配置转换逻辑:在管道中添加转换步骤,例如过滤、聚合、字段映射等,以满足业务需求。
- 运行和监控管道:启动数据管道并监控其运行状态。Data Fusion提供了详细的日志和指标,帮助用户跟踪管道的执行情况。
- 调度自动化:设置管道的调度规则,实现数据的定期更新和自动化处理。
实际应用场景
以下是一些典型的应用场景,展示Data Fusion如何帮助企业整合异构数据:

- 客户数据整合:企业可能拥有来自CRM系统、网站分析工具和社交媒体平台的客户数据。通过Data Fusion,可以将这些数据整合到一个统一的数据仓库中,形成完整的客户画像。
- 物联网数据分析:物联网设备生成的数据通常具有多样化的格式和结构。Data Fusion可以帮助企业将这些数据标准化并存储到BigQuery中,以便进行进一步的分析。
- 日志分析:企业可能需要分析来自服务器、应用程序和网络设备的日志数据。Data Fusion可以整合这些日志,提取关键信息,并生成可视化报告。
总结
谷歌云Data Fusion是一款功能强大且易于使用的数据集成工具,能够帮助企业高效整合异构数据。其完全托管的服务模式、可视化界面、强大的扩展性以及与谷歌云生态的无缝集成,使其成为企业数据管理的理想选择。通过Data Fusion,企业可以快速构建数据管道,实现数据的提取、转换和加载,从而为业务决策提供可靠的数据支持。无论是客户数据整合、物联网数据分析还是日志处理,Data Fusion都能提供灵活、高效的解决方案,助力企业在数据驱动的时代中保持竞争优势。

kf@jusoucn.com
4008-020-360


4008-020-360
